@becomes/cms
Version:
Simple CMS for building APIs.
20 lines (19 loc) • 501 B
TypeScript
import { User } from '../models/user.model';
export declare class UserFactory {
static get instance(): User;
static admin(config: {
username: string;
email: string;
firstName: string;
lastName: string;
avatarUri?: string;
}): User;
static user(config: {
username: string;
email: string;
firstName: string;
lastName: string;
avatarUri?: string;
}): User;
static removeProtected(user: User): any;
}